About this course

Speech and language therapy is the clinical health profession concerned with the assessment, diagnosis and treatment of communication disorders and difficulties with swallowing. It serves people of all ages, from infants with developmental speech and language delays to adults who have experienced stroke, head injury, neurological disease or cancer affecting the voice, speech or swallowing. Speech and language therapists work across a wide range of settings, including the NHS, schools, social care and the independent sector, and their work combines scientific assessment with the highly personal and relationship-centred dimensions of clinical practice. At Queen Margaret University in Edinburgh the four-year full-time programme leads to both a BSc (Hons) and a Master of Speech and Language Therapy, offering an integrated qualification that prepares you thoroughly for professional registration. You will develop expertise in speech and language development, the assessment of communication disorders across different conditions and age groups, and the evidence-based therapeutic approaches used to support communication and swallowing. Clinical placements run throughout all four years, giving you practical experience in a range of settings alongside your academic development. On-campus specialist clinical facilities add further depth to your practical training. Speech and language therapy is a regulated profession, and qualifying graduates are eligible to register with the Health and Care Professions Council, which is required to practise in the UK. Graduates work across NHS hospitals, community services, schools, early years settings and specialist residential and day services. Some go on to develop specialist expertise in areas such as autism, acquired neurological conditions, cleft palate or augmentative and alternative communication. Postgraduate research in speech and language sciences is also a route for those drawn to the academic and scientific dimensions of the profession.
